Job Description

As our new Head of Community Activation, you’ll lead a global strategic function that fuels both the head and heart of our practitioner community. This is a rare opportunity to shape a role that blends inspiration, activation, and purpose to drive measurable commercial growth and cultural impact.

You’ll architect and deliver an enterprise-wide strategy that connects, empowers, and grows our practitioner, Faculty, and Associate Consultant (AC) communities.

Your mission: to create vibrant, joyful networks that celebrate belonging while driving adoption, retention, and revenue growth. From championing our purpose-led Gift of Discovery programme to curating flagship experiences like Insights Live, you’ll transform human connection into sustained business success—ensuring our community shines as a living expression of our brand and strategy.

How to prepare for a job interview at Insights

Showcase Your Leadership Style

You’ll want to thoroughly convey your unique approach to leadership. During the interview with Insights, be ready to share real-life examples of how you've inspired and motivated teams in the past. Think about specific achievements that illustrate your strategic thinking and your ability to drive results.

Brush Up on Management Theories

Expect some technical questions related to management theories and practices. Brush up on concepts like transformational leadership, servant leadership, or situational leadership. Be prepared to discuss how you would apply these theories to the role at Insights, especially in the specific context of the challenges they’re currently facing.

Craft Your Vision for the Company

Since this is a full-time leadership role, spending time thinking about your vision for Insights could really set you apart. Consider potential strategies for growth and how you would lead teams towards achieving them. This shows not just enthusiasm, but also strategic foresight that they’ll likely be looking for in a candidate.

Emphasise Team Dynamics and Culture

In corporate leadership, team dynamics and organisational culture are everything. Be ready to discuss how you've fostered a positive work environment in previous roles. Bring up examples of how you've managed diverse teams effectively—this will resonate well at Insights as they’re likely seeking a candidate who can enhance their workplace culture.
